Slovenia Progressive Income Tax 2026 - Rates and Brackets
Slovenia operates progressive personal income tax system with 5 brackets ranging 16-50%. Brackets adjusted annually for inflation. Lower earners benefit from 16% rate and general relief allowance. Higher earners face 50% top rate above €82,346. Understanding Slovenia tax brackets essential for salary negotiation and tax planning.
02Slovenia Cryptocurrency Tax 2026 - Capital Gains and Mining
Slovenia crypto tax regime among most favorable in EU for long-term holders. Capital gains tax rates decrease with holding period: 25% if under 5 years, reducing to 0% after 15 years. Slovenia cryptocurrency mining taxed as income. Crypto trading as business subject to income tax. Understanding Slovenia crypto taxation essential for investors.
03Slovenia Social Security Contributions 2026
Slovenia social contributions fund pension, health, unemployment systems. Employee pays 22.1%, employer ~16.1%. Total ~38% - moderate compared Western Europe (France 65%). Maximum contribution base €82,346 limits high earner obligations. Slovenia social security mandatory for employees and self-employed.
04Slovenia Dividend and Capital Income Tax 2026
Slovenia taxes capital income separately from employment income. Dividends 27.5% flat rate. Interest 27.5%. Capital gains progressive 0-25% based on holding period. Real estate gains taxed similarly. Understanding Slovenia capital income taxation crucial for investors.
05Slovenia Tax Deductions and Allowances 2026
Slovenia general relief €4,653 annually reduces taxable income for all. Additional relief for dependents, students, disabled persons. Deductions available for pension contributions, donations, insurance. Understanding Slovenia tax allowances significantly reduces liability. Proper claiming essential Slovenia tax optimization.
